2025 Brewers Week in Review: Week 18

July 28, 2025 by Brew Crew Ball

MLB: Miami Marlins at Milwaukee Brewers
Benny Sieu-Imagn Images

Win streak is snapped, but Brewers are still tied atop NL Central heading into big week against Cubs

Last Week’s Results

  • Monday: Brewers 6, Mariners 0
  • Tuesday: Mariners 1, Brewers 0
  • Wednesday: Brewers 10, Mariners 2
  • Friday: Marlins 5, Brewers 1
  • Saturday: Marlins 7, Brewers 4
  • Sunday: Brewers 3, Marlins 2

Division Standings

  • Chicago Cubs: 62-43
  • Milwaukee Brewers: 62-43
  • Cincinnati Reds: 56-50 (6.5 GB)
  • St. Louis Cardinals: 54-53 (9 GB)
  • Pittsburgh Pirates: 44-62 (18.5 GB)

Last Week

  • Cubs: 3-3
  • Brewers: 3-3
  • Reds: 4-2
  • Cardinals: 3-4
  • Pirates: 5-1

Top Pitching Performance of the Week

Nobody had a flashy performance this week, but Brandon Woodruff did a great job keeping Milwaukee in both of his starts this week. He went six innings in outings against the Mariners and Marlins, allowing no runs and striking out five against Seattle before allowing two runs and striking out six against Miami. That puts his ERA at 2.01 through four starts this year, as he now has 29 strikeouts across 22 1⁄3 innings.

Top Hitting Performance of the Week

How about Jackson Chourio extending his hitting streak to 20 games? He went 11-for-24 across six games this week, including a homer, four doubles, five RBIs, four runs, and a steal while hitting .458/.500/.750. He’s now hitting .276/.308/.472 with 17 homers, 67 RBIs, 70 runs, 29 doubles, and 18 steals.

Injury Notes & Roster Moves

  • The Brewers sent LHPs Rob Zastryzny and Robert Gasser on rehab assignments to Triple-A Nashville and High-A Wisconsin, respectively. Zastyzny could return as soon as this week, while Gasser is targeting a late-August return
  • OF Sal Frelick was activated from a quick IL stint on Saturday, with utilityman Tyler Black sent back to Triple-A Nashville to open up the roster spot.
  • The Brewers have now signed all 12 of their draft picks from the first 10 rounds in the 2025 MLB Draft, and they’ll look to add a few more to that list before the deadline later this week. They’ve also added a few undrafted free agents, including RHPs Caleb Nieman, Peyton Niksch, Jarrette Bonet, Thomas Conrad, and Tanner Perry, and OF Malachai Halterman.
